Benjamin Franklin Day is a wonderful opportunity to celebrate the life and legacy of one of America's most influential founding fathers. Observed on a day in January, this holiday marks the birthday of the renowned statesman, scientist, writer, and philosopher, born on January 17, 1706. Franklin's contributions to society are profound, and honoring his memory can be both enriching and economical.
